Andrzej Ehrenfeucht
Andrzej Ehrenfeucht is a Polish American mathematician and computer scientist. He formulated the Ehrenfeucht–Fraïssé game, using the back-and-forth method given by Roland Fraïssé in his PhD thesis. The Ehrenfeucht–Mycielski sequence is also named after him.
Elazar Shach
Elazar Menachem Man Shach, fue un jaredí europeo y reconocido antisionista que se radicó y vivió en Israel. Era el director de la Yeshivá de Ponevezh ubicada en Bnei Brak, y fundó el partido político Déguel HaTorá, que representaba a los judíos asquenazim lituanos en la Knéset, el Parlamento de Israel, muchos de los cuales lo consideraban el Gadol HaDor y utilizaban el nombre honorífico Marán para referirse a él.

Viktoras Muntianas
Viktoras Muntianas is a Lithuanian politician of Moldovan descent and former Speaker of the Seimas. In 1968 he graduated from the high school in Marijampolė. In 1973 he enrolled in the Vilnius Civil Engineering Institute, completing his studies in 1978. Between 1986 and 1990 he was first deputy of Kėdainiai municipality chairman. Later he started a career in business, becoming manager of Ūkio bankas filial in Kėdainiai in 1994. After two years he became vice-president of Vikonda concern.

Vincentas Sladkevičius
Vincentas Sladkevičius, M.I.C. was a Lithuanian Cardinal of the Roman Catholic Church. He served as Archbishop of Kaunas from 1989 to 1996, and was elevated to the cardinalate in 1988.
Audrius Butkevičius
Audrius Butkevičius is a Lithuanian politician, a signatory of the Act of the Re-Establishment of the State of Lithuania, member of the Seimas from 25 November 1996 till 18 October 2000. He does not belong to any party.

Bronislovas Lubys
Bronislovas Lubys was a Lithuanian entrepreneur, former Prime Minister of Lithuania, signatory of the Act of the Re-Establishment of the State of Lithuania, and businessman.
